Perth location & geography
Perth, the capital city of Western Australia, is situated on the southwestern coast of the continent. It enjoys a prime location with the Indian Ocean to its west and the vast Outback region to the east. Perth is known for its Mediterranean climate, characterized by hot, dry summers and mild, wet winters. The city is blessed with an abundance of sunshine, making it a perfect destination for outdoor activities and beach lovers. Its proximity to the Indian Ocean offers opportunities for surfing, swimming, and enjoying the coastal lifestyle. The Swan River flows through the city, providing picturesque landscapes and a vibrant waterfront area. Perth's geography is diverse, with sandy beaches, expansive parks and gardens, and nearby wine regions like the Swan Valley. The city also serves as a gateway to exploring the natural wonders of Western Australia, including the famous Pinnacles Desert and the stunning landscapes of the Kimberley region.
Getting to and around Perth
Perth, being a major city in Western Australia, is well-connected to various domestic and international destinations. The city is served by Perth Airport, which has regular flights from major Australian cities as well as international destinations. From the airport, travelers can take taxis, shuttle buses, or ride-sharing services to reach the city center. Once in Perth, getting around is convenient with an extensive public transportation system. Transperth operates buses, trains, and ferries, providing easy access to different parts of the city and its surrounding areas. Visitors can also explore Perth by renting a car, which offers flexibility and convenience, especially for exploring attractions beyond the city limits. Cycling is another popular option, with dedicated bike lanes and shared paths available throughout the city. Additionally, Perth's compact city center makes it walkable, allowing visitors to explore many attractions on foot.
